What You Get
Every group returns 30+ fields of structured data:
| Field | Description | Example |
|---|---|---|
id | Unique Meetup group identifier | "76645" |
name | Full group name | "The Portland Hiking Meetup Group" |
urlname | URL slug | "the-portland-hiking-meetup-group" |
description | Full group description | "We are an inclusive and diverse group..." |
markdownDescription | Description converted to Markdown | "We are an inclusive..." |
membersCount | Total member count | 12465 |
topicCategoryId | Category ID | "684" |
topicCategoryName | Category name | "Travel & Outdoor" |
topics | Topic tags | ["Hiking", "Backpacking", "Camping"] |
city | Group's city | "Portland" |
state | State or region | "OR" |
country | ISO country code | "us" |
lat | Latitude | 45.5 |
lon | Longitude | -122.69 |
link | Full Meetup URL | "https://www.meetup.com/the-portland-hiking-meetup-group" |
foundedDate | ISO 8601 founding timestamp | "2004-01-03T16:13:34-08:00" |
timezone | Group timezone | "America/Los_Angeles" |
isPrivate | Private group flag | false |
joinMode | OPEN or APPROVAL | "OPEN" |
status | PAID or FREE | "PAID" |
zip | ZIP or postal code | "97201" |
isNewGroup | Whether the group is newly created | false |
coverImage | URL of the group's cover/featured photo | "https://secure.meetupstatic.com/photos/event/...jpeg" |
organizerId | Meetup member ID of the organizer | "33743752" |
organizerName | Name of the group organizer | "Elena Bloudek" |
organizerPhoto | URL of the organizer's profile photo | "https://secure.meetupstatic.com/photos/member/...jpeg" |
rating | Average rating for group events (0.0β5.0) | 4.71 |
ratingTotal | Total number of ratings | 14 |
sampleMemberNames | Sample list of member names | ["Sandra", "SofΓa", "Matt"] |
sampleMemberCount | Number of sample member names returned | 10 |
socialMedia | Social media links keyed by service name | {"instagram": "https://..."} |
contactInfo.phones | Phone numbers found in the description | ["+34696548107"] |
contactInfo.emails | Email addresses found in the description | ["hello@example.com"] |
otherUrls | External URLs extracted from description | ["https://chat.whatsapp.com/..."] |
Inputs
| Input | Required | Default | Description |
|---|---|---|---|
searchKeywords | β | β | What to search for: yoga, board games, machine learning, hiking β anything |
location | β | β | City name (Berlin), lat/lon (52.52,13.40), or ZIP (20095) |
topicCategory | β | All | Filter to one of 20 categories: Technology, Sports & Fitness, Career & Business, and more |
radius | β | 25 | Search radius in miles (1β200) |
maxResults | β | 50 | Groups to return (1β500) |

FAQ
Do I need a Meetup account? No. This scraper only accesses publicly available group data. No account, login, or cookies required.
What locations are supported? Any location on Earth β city name, lat/lon pair, or ZIP/postal code. All inputs are geocoded automatically.
How fresh is the data? Live. Every run queries Meetup directly, so member counts, descriptions, and statuses reflect the current state of each group.
How is this different from the Meetup Events Scraper? Groups are persistent communities. Events are individual meetups tied to dates. Use this scraper to understand the community landscape; use the Events Scraper to find what's happening next week. For maximum coverage, use both.
What categories can I filter by? Art & Culture, Career & Business, Community & Environment, Dancing, Games, Health & Wellbeing, Hobbies & Passions, Identity & Language, Movements & Politics, Music, Parents & Family, Pets & Animals, Religion & Spirituality, Science & Education, Social Activities, Sports & Fitness, Support & Coaching, Technology, Travel & Outdoor, and Writing.
How many groups can I get in one run? Up to 500. The default is 50 β a good starting point for most searches. Run multiple times with different keywords or locations and combine the results for broader coverage.
